It really is all you need in a book and the last few pages gave me a few ideas: modes and the relative minors and parrellel modes. dont worry if you dont know the modes - do you know the minor and major pentatonics in five positions ? If not this is a good reference book for them - though its not a walk through course - more a summary page on each scale. For the money - if nothing else it gives the intermediate player a road map.

I got this book having felt dissatisfied with the teaching of scales in 'Rock guitar for dummies', and wasn't expecting much for the price, but this book covers a wide range of the more common scales and also quite a few modes, and more importantly explains them quite well too. All in all for the price, this is an excellent reference book, my only gripe is that the scale patterns aren't illustrated all along the neck (they are only shown in 1 or 2 adjacent positions), but what do you expect for under 3 quid??
